Now, before we get into the fundamentals of how you can watch 'Cyrus' right now, here are some finer points about the Scott Free Productions, Fox Searchlight Pictures, Dune Entertainment III, Duplass Brothers Productions drama flick.
Released January 23rd, 2010, 'Cyrus' stars John C. Reilly, Jonah Hill, Marisa Tomei, Catherine Keener The R movie has a runtime of about 1 hr 31 min, and received a user score of 59 (out of 100) on TMDb, which assembled reviews from 396 knowledgeable users.
You probably already know what the movie's about, but just in case... Here's the plot: "With John's social life at a standstill and his ex-wife about to get remarried, a down on his luck divorcée finally meets the woman of his dreams, only to discover she has another man in her life - her son. Before long, the two are locked in a battle of wits for the woman they both love-and it appears only one man can be left standing when it's over."
'Cyrus' is currently available to rent, purchase, or stream via subscription on YouTube, Microsoft Store, Vudu, Google Play Movies, Cinemax Amazon Channel, Amazon Video, Apple iTunes, Cinemax Apple TV Channel, and AMC on Demand .
